The Complete Basics of UI/UX Design: A Comprehensive Guide for Beginners

Nirdhum Narayan
3 min readOct 10, 2023


In today’s digital world, user interface (UI) and user experience (UX) design play a crucial role in creating successful and engaging digital products. Whether it’s a website, mobile application, or any other interactive platform, a well-executed UI/UX design can make all the difference in user satisfaction and product success.

This article aims to provide beginners with a comprehensive understanding of UI/UX design, its fundamental principles, and the essential processes involved.

  • Understanding UI and UX Design: UI Design: User Interface design focuses on the visual and interactive elements of a digital product. It involves creating visually appealing layouts, selecting appropriate colors, and typography, and designing intuitive and responsive user interfaces.

UX Design: User Experience design focuses on enhancing overall user satisfaction by improving the usability, accessibility, and enjoyment of a product. It involves understanding user behavior, conducting research, creating user personas, and designing intuitive interactions to meet user needs.

UI/UX design - sketch
UI/UX Design

Importance of UI/UX Design: A well-designed UI/UX offers numerous benefits, including:

  • Improved user satisfaction and engagement
  • Increased user retention and loyalty
  • Enhanced brand perception and credibility
  • Higher conversion rates and sales
  • Reduced support and maintenance costs

Key Principles of UI/UX Design:

  • User-Centered Design: Put the user at the center of the design process and prioritize their needs, preferences, and goals.
  • Consistency: Maintain consistent visual elements and interactions throughout the product to provide a familiar and intuitive experience.
  • Simplicity: Keep the design simple and avoid clutter to enhance usability and reduce cognitive load.
  • Visual Hierarchy: Use visual cues, such as size, color, and placement, to guide users’ attention and prioritize important elements.
  • Accessibility: Ensure the product is accessible to users with disabilities, adhering to WCAG guidelines.
  • Feedback and Responsiveness: Provide timely and meaningful feedback to users’ actions and create responsive designs that adapt to different devices and screen sizes.

UI/UX Design Process:

  • Research: Conduct user research to understand target users, their goals, and their pain points. Analyze competitors and industry trends.
  • User Personas: Create fictional representations of your target users to better understand their motivations, needs, and behaviors.
  • Information Architecture: Develop a clear and organized structure for content and features to facilitate easy navigation.
  • Wireframing: Create low-fidelity wireframes to outline the layout, structure, and functionality of the product.
  • Visual Design: Apply visual elements, such as colors, typography, and imagery, to the wireframes to create a visually appealing design.
  • Prototyping: Build interactive prototypes to test the usability and flow of the design.
  • User Testing: Gather feedback from real users through usability testing to identify issues and make necessary improvements.
  • Iteration: Refine and iterate the design based on user feedback and testing results.
UI wireframe sketching using pen and paper
UI/UX Design — Wireframes

Tools for UI/UX Design: There are numerous tools available to assist designers in the UI/UX design process. Some popular ones include:

  • Figma
  • Sketch
  • Adobe XD
  • InVision
  • Balsamiq
  • Axure RP

Additional Tips for UI/UX Designers:

  • Stay up-to-date with design trends, emerging technologies, and industry best practices.
  • Seek feedback from users, colleagues, and experts to continually improve your skills.
  • Collaborate effectively with other team members, such as developers and product managers.
  • Practice empathy and put yourself in the users’ shoes to better understand their needs.
  • Keep testing and iterating your design to ensure continuous improvement.


UI/UX design is a crucial aspect of creating successful digital products. By understanding the fundamental principles, following a well-defined design process, and incorporating user-centered approaches, beginners can create engaging and user-friendly experiences.

Remember, great design is an iterative process that requires continuous learning, testing, and refinement. With practice and dedication, anyone can become a skilled UI/UX designer. So, embrace the basics, experiment, and enjoy the journey of crafting exceptional user experiences.



Product Design Engineer with a drive for excellence and a commitment to innovation, constantly striving to push the boundaries of what's possible.